Why this rating

This daycare earned 3 out of 5 stars overall. Structural quality reflects North Carolina's licensing baseline. North Carolina caps infant ratios at 1:5, toddler ratios at 1:6, and preschool ratios at 1:20. Lead teachers must hold a High School Diploma. Teachers must complete 20 hours of annual training. No objective process measures (e.g., state quality rating or national accreditation) are available for this daycare. The overall rating reflects structural features only.

Inspection History

2 Inspection Visits Since 2025 · 5 Findings · 0% Corrected at Visit
5 Important

Across 2 inspections since 2025, the issues cited most often were Licensing & Administrative Compliance (2), Children's Records & Files (1), and Child Maltreatment Prevention (1). None of the 5 findings were critical.

See All 2 Inspection Visits
  1. Apr 9, 20264 Findings4 Important
    • All Stationary Equipment, More Than 18 Inches High, Was Not Installed Over Protective Surfacing.

      The mulch has deteriorated on the playground, and the surfacing is now dirt. Violation confirmed corrected by letter received from provider on 4/15/2026

    • Incident Logs Were Not Completed and Maintained as Required.

      Incident reports were completed and not documented on the incident log. Violation confirmed corrected by letter received from provider on 4/15/2026

    • Application for Employment and Date of Birth Was Not on File for All Staff.

      Applications were not on file for three staff. Violation confirmed corrected by letter received from provider on 4/15/2026

  2. Dec 18, 20251 Finding1 Important
    • Bed, Cribs, Playpens, Cots or Mats Were Not Placed at Least 18" Apart or Separated by Partitions When in Use.

      The cots in space #5E were not 18" apart or separated by partitions during nap. Violation confirmed corrected by letter received from provider on 12/30/2025
